使用javascript 如何获取鼠标的位置呢?
获取光标的位置 获取鼠标坐标
先看效果
核心方法:
/*** * 返回鼠标的坐标 * @param e * @returns {{x: (Number|pageX|*), y: (Number|pageY|*)}} */ var getCoordInDocument = function(e) { e = e || window.event; var x = e.pageX || (e.clientX + (document.documentElement.scrollLeft || document.body.scrollLeft)); var y= e.pageY || (e.clientY + (document.documentElement.scrollTop || document.body.scrollTop)); return {'x':x,'y':y}; }
页面代码:
<!DOCTYPE html> <html> <head lang="en"> <meta charset="UTF-8"> <title></title> <script type="text/javascript" src="svn_js/common_util.js"></script> <script type="text/javascript"> var getCoordInDocumentExample = function(){ var coords = document.getElementById("coordAreas"); coords.onmousemove = function(e){ var pointer = getCoordInDocument(e); var coord = document.getElementById("coord"); coord.innerHTML = "X,Y=("+pointer.x+", "+pointer.y+")"; } } window.onload = function(){ getCoordInDocumentExample(); }; </script> </head> <body> <div id="coordAreas" style="width:500px;height:200px;background:#F2F1D7;border:2px solid #9C89CB;border-radius: 5px 5px 5px 5px;"> 请在此移动鼠标。 </div> <br /> <div id="coord" style="width:500px;border:2px solid #9C89CB;border-radius: 5px 5px 5px 5px;"> </div> </body> </html>
相关推荐
在C#编程中,获取鼠标当前位置的坐标是一项基础但实用的操作,这通常涉及到Windows API的交互或者是.NET Framework提供的鼠标事件。下面将详细讲解如何通过C#实现这一功能,并结合具体的代码示例进行说明。 首先,...
在Windows操作系统中,使用Qt库开发应用程序时,我们经常需要获取鼠标的相关信息,例如位置坐标和移动趋势。本文将深入探讨如何在Qt环境下实现这一功能,特别关注在X轴上的相对位移以及根据移动速度调整的位移绝对值...
获取鼠标的坐标,通过js任意获取鼠标点击处的位置坐标。
### 获取鼠标坐标的基本原理 鼠标在屏幕上的位置可以通过一个二维坐标系统来表示,其中屏幕左上角为原点(0,0),向右水平方向为x轴正方向,向下垂直方向为y轴正方向。每个像素点都有一个唯一的(x,y)坐标值。当用户...
获取鼠标在当前屏幕坐标系中的位置信息 将鼠标移动到要获取位置的点,然后按F10,就会弹出当前的坐标值
在这个函数中,我们可以使用`CWnd::GetMessagePos`方法来获取鼠标的当前位置,该位置是以屏幕坐标表示的。返回的`CPoint`对象包含了X和Y坐标。另一种方式是通过`CWnd::ScreenToClient`将屏幕坐标转换为视图或窗口内...
以下是一个简单的示例,展示了如何在窗体的MouseMove事件中获取鼠标坐标: ```csharp public partial class MainForm : Form { public MainForm() { InitializeComponent(); this.MouseMove += new ...
标题"java获取鼠标坐标位置swing"指的是利用Java Swing来编程,实现在Swing组件上显示鼠标移动时的坐标位置。 首先,要获取鼠标坐标,我们需要导入必要的Java Swing库,如`javax.swing.*` 和 `java.awt.event.*`。...
在C#编程中,获取全局鼠标坐标是一项常见的需求,特别是在开发需要实时监控鼠标位置的应用时。全局鼠标坐标指的是鼠标在操作系统屏幕上的精确位置,不受任何特定窗口或应用程序限制。下面我们将详细探讨如何在C#中...
如果需要在非客户区获取鼠标坐标,比如整个窗口包括边框和标题栏,可以使用GetCursorPos函数,它返回一个CPoint对象,表示鼠标在屏幕上的位置: ```cpp CPoint ptScreen; GetCursorPos(&ptScreen); ``` 然后,可以...
标题“wincc获取鼠标位置.7z”提示我们这是一个关于如何在WinCC项目中获取鼠标位置的教程或程序。描述中的“下载程序时,请参考博客文章”意味着可能有一个相关的技术博客提供了更详细的步骤和解释。 WinCC获取鼠标...
# PyQt5追踪鼠标当前位置 移动鼠标和点击鼠标获取坐标 1. 简洁明了的代码,帮助快速学习鼠标事件; 2. 重定义mouseMoveEvent事件实现移动鼠标显示坐标; 3. 重定义mousePressEvent事件实现点击鼠标显示坐标。
### JavaScript 获取鼠标当前位置坐标并显示 #### 知识点概览 本文将详细介绍如何使用JavaScript来获取鼠标在页面上的当前位置坐标,并实时显示这些坐标值。该功能主要涉及到以下几个知识点: 1. **事件监听器...
下载之后,无需安装,直接点击pyautogu.exe,可以获取鼠标实时坐标位置,辅助支持开发自动化软件、游戏辅助软件、网页自动化、爬虫、游戏外挂等
本程序采用德国MVTEC公司的软件写的一个鼠标实时获取鼠标位置的程序
本知识点将深入讲解如何利用LabVIEW调用`user32.dll`这个系统级库,获取鼠标坐标。 `user32.dll`是Windows操作系统中的一个重要组件,它提供了大量与用户界面相关的函数,包括对鼠标和键盘事件的处理。其中,`...
在IT领域,尤其是在软件开发中,获取鼠标在屏幕上的当前位置是一项常见的需求。这通常涉及到操作系统级别的交互和事件处理。本文将深入探讨如何使用C++语言实现这个功能,并讲解相关的关键知识点。 首先,我们要...
在这个特定的【QT】获取鼠标坐标以及按键响应的项目中,我们可以深入探讨以下几个关键知识点: 1. **QT事件处理**: QT中的事件处理是基于信号和槽机制的。当用户进行鼠标点击或键盘按键操作时,系统会产生相应的...
在Web开发中,特别是在JavaScript编程中,获取鼠标坐标是一项常见的需求,用于实现各种交互效果,如拖放功能、点击位置分析等。在不同的浏览器中,实现这一功能的方法可能有所不同,因此需要进行兼容性处理。以下是...
在 MFC 编程中,获取 Picture 控件的鼠标点击坐标位置是一项常见的需求,特别是在自定义 Dialog 中加入了 Picture 控件的情况下。以下将详细介绍如何获取 Picture 控件的鼠标点击坐标位置。 首先,需要重载 CDialog...